Part I: Flying the P38
Pilots proclaimed it the hottest fighter of World War II. Now you can decide. The famous Lightning claimed its name by birthright: it was the first fighter to amazingly top 400 miles per hour! Warbird pilot Jeff Ethell takes you along on a mission in this incredible turbocharged, twin-engined interceptor - an aerial adventure, complete with the thrill of digital Dolby Surround sound.
Part II: The Young Pilots
Why did teenage kids sign up to face the terror of aerial combat? Was it the chance to fly the fastest fighter planes? Experience the thrill of horsepower and firepower? Wounded in a crash landing, pilot Richard Brown wanted so badly to continue to fly, he kept his leg injury a secret. Young pilot Art Thorsen had a chilling premonition that became real terror in thick fog above Berlin. Both amazing true stories reveal the personal lives of The Young Pilots.
